Output 359966bbb104526052e7f520950b9fc9e2fb6aa014f56e0ffcd2a26f649825ef:0

value
559600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71edcdb20e548a3e800212646d4647d6216b1123 OP_EQUAL
address
3C5RA6bbuKHXnLvyP2bHXdzg5w4uQ9MJ7F
transaction
359966bbb104526052e7f520950b9fc9e2fb6aa014f56e0ffcd2a26f649825ef
confirmations
258235
spent
true